Tips on Working from Home as a Contract Mortgage Processor

There are many things you need to do before you can successfully work from home as a contract mortgage processor. Here we will discuss some tips and ideas for at-home work opportunities in the field of contract mortgage loan processing or commonly referred to as "outsource mortgage processing".

To work from home as a contract loan processor you will need to do the following:

1) Make sure to have a quiet at-home work environment. This means no dogs barking in the background. No kids screaming. No pots and pans clinging. And if you are going to forward your land line to a cell phone, make sure not to answer your phone while there is background noise. Remember, it is a privilege to work from home and you as a contract processor cannot take this for granted. There are many people across the country that would love to work from home. So make sure that you recognize this benefit and take all measures to ensure you maintain a quiet at home work environment.

2) It's not a bad idea to incorporate yourself as you do not want to retain liability if your mortgage broker or borrower performs fraud. You can do it directly through your state's website or through companies like www.incorporate.com, although it's a little more expensive that way.

3) Make sure that you equip your home office with everything you need to be a successful loan processor. So what do you really need to work from home as a contract processor? Phone. Fax. Fast Internet. Computer. Origination software (i.e. Caylx Point or Ellie Mae's Encompass). Perhaps one filing cabinet. And your favorite mug to put your pens in ;)

4) In order to be a loan processor who can work at home it's not a bad idea to also do other things. Such as notary. Real estate agent. Virtual administrative assistant. This way you can supplement your income during the slow times. But most importantly, you need to get yourself out there. Don't fall victim to watching TV or playing with the kids all day. Go out there and network yourself with local mortgage brokers, real estate agents, etc.

5) If you do not have loan processor training, then it's a good idea to start today. Without sound mortgage loan processing training, most mortgage brokers will NOT hire you! Mortgage brokerage firms do not have the time, nor the resources to train newly hired loan processors, so it's up to you, as the independent mortgage processor, to acquire mortgage processing training. Unfortunately, there are only a few legitimate mortgage career training schools on the internet and ever fewer in person, classroom training schools. 6) And finally and most important, join local and national networking organizations in your chosen field of mortgage loan processing. Organizations like your local Chamber of Commerce, National Association of Mortgage Processors, Kauffmen Center for Entreprenuership, Small Business Administation (SBA), and SCORE.org, just to name a few.
